数据库开发的未来:智能化工具如何重塑小型数据库系统

最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E

数据库开发的未来:智能化工具如何重塑小型数据库系统

在当今数字化时代,数据已成为企业最宝贵的资产之一。无论是初创公司还是大型企业,构建一个高效、可靠的小型数据库系统都是至关重要的。然而,对于许多开发者来说,尤其是编程新手,开发和维护一个功能完备的小型数据库系统并非易事。面对复杂的数据库设计、SQL查询优化以及性能调优等问题,开发者往往需要投入大量时间和精力。

幸运的是,随着人工智能(AI)技术的发展,一款全新的智能化工具正在改变这一现状——它不仅简化了开发流程,还显著提升了开发效率。本文将探讨这款智能化工具在小型数据库系统开发中的应用场景和巨大价值,并引导读者了解其带来的变革。

1. 简化数据库设计与建模

在传统的小型数据库系统开发中,数据库设计是一个复杂且耗时的过程。开发者需要考虑表结构、字段类型、索引设置等多方面因素,以确保数据库能够高效运行。此外,还需要编写大量的SQL语句来创建和管理数据库对象。

借助于智能化工具,开发者可以通过自然语言描述需求,快速生成完整的数据库设计方案。例如,在开发一个图书借阅系统时,开发者只需输入“创建一个包含书籍信息、借阅记录和用户信息的数据库”,工具就能自动生成相应的SQL脚本,包括表结构定义、外键约束以及必要的索引设置。这不仅大大减少了手动编写代码的工作量,还降低了出错的概率。

2. 自动化SQL查询优化

SQL查询优化是提高数据库性能的关键环节。对于不熟悉SQL优化技巧的开发者来说,这项任务往往充满挑战。他们需要分析查询计划、调整索引策略、重写查询语句,以确保数据库能够在高并发环境下稳定运行。

智能化工具通过内置的AI引擎,能够自动分析SQL查询并提出优化建议。例如,当开发者输入一条复杂的查询语句时,工具会立即识别潜在的性能瓶颈,并提供改进建议。不仅如此,工具还可以根据历史查询数据,智能推荐最佳实践,帮助开发者持续优化数据库性能。这种自动化的方式使得即使是初学者也能轻松应对复杂的SQL优化问题。

3. 智能化的错误诊断与修复

在开发过程中,难免会遇到各种各样的错误和异常情况。传统的调试方法通常依赖于日志分析和手动排查,费时费力。而智能化工具则提供了一种全新的解决方案——通过AI驱动的智能诊断系统,快速定位并修复问题。

当数据库出现异常时,开发者只需将错误信息输入到工具的对话框中,AI助手会立即进行分析,并提供详细的错误原因和修复建议。例如,在处理SQL注入攻击时,工具不仅能检测到潜在的安全漏洞,还能自动生成安全的SQL语句,防止类似问题再次发生。这种即时反馈机制极大地提高了开发效率,缩短了问题解决的时间。

4. 提升团队协作与知识共享

在一个项目中,团队成员之间的协作和知识共享至关重要。尤其是在涉及多个数据库操作的情况下,如何确保所有成员都能理解和使用相同的最佳实践成为了一个难题。

智能化工具通过集成在线文档、示例代码库和社区支持等功能,为团队提供了丰富的学习资源和技术交流平台。例如,当团队成员遇到SQL语法问题时,可以直接在工具内搜索相关教程或向社区提问,获得即时的帮助和支持。此外,工具还支持版本控制和协作编辑,允许多个开发者同时对同一个数据库项目进行修改和优化,极大地方便了团队协作。

5. 实战案例:从零开始构建图书借阅系统

为了更好地展示智能化工具在小型数据库系统开发中的应用效果,我们以一个实际案例为例——HNU大学的学生们在完成程序设计作业时,使用智能化工具成功构建了一个图书借阅系统。

在这个项目中,学生们利用工具提供的自然语言对话功能,快速完成了数据库设计、SQL查询编写和性能优化等一系列任务。通过简单的命令行输入,如“创建一个包含书籍信息、借阅记录和用户信息的数据库”,工具自动生成了完整的SQL脚本。而在后续的开发过程中,每当遇到复杂的查询语句或性能瓶颈时,学生们都可以依靠工具提供的智能优化建议,迅速解决问题。

最终,学生们不仅按时完成了作业,还在期末考试中取得了优异的成绩。更重要的是,他们通过这个项目积累了宝贵的经验,掌握了现代化数据库开发的最佳实践。

结语

智能化工具的出现,标志着小型数据库系统开发进入了一个全新的时代。它不仅简化了开发流程,提升了开发效率,还为开发者提供了强大的技术支持和学习资源。无论你是编程新手还是经验丰富的开发者,都可以从中受益匪浅。

如果你也想体验这种革命性的开发方式,不妨下载并试用这款智能化工具。相信它将为你带来前所未有的编程体验,助力你在数据库开发领域取得更大的成功。


下载链接: 点击这里下载智能化工具

了解更多: 访问官方网站获取更多信息

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

代码下载链接: https://pan.quark.cn/s/a4b39357ea24 iSecure Center综合安防管理平台配置手册V2.0最新完整版。综合安防管理平台是一个集成了多种功能的智能化系统,通过接入视频监控、停车场、门禁以及报警检测等设备,达成安防信息化集成与联动。以电子地图作为核心载体,融合各类安防设备,达成安防信息化集成与联动。 【海康威视iSecure Center综合安防管理平台配置手册 V2.0.0】是专门针对该公司的安防管理系统而编写的详细指南。iSecure Center是一个集成化、智能化的解决方案,其目标是通过整合视频监控、停车场管理、门禁控制和报警系统等多个安全子系统,达成全面的安防信息化集成与联动。平台的核心作用是借助电子地图作为基础,整合各种安防功能,以提供高效且全面的安全监控和管理。 手册中明确指出,iSecure Center的配置和使用仅限于海康威视HIKVISION的用户,并且详细说明了版权和法律声明,强调手册内容的所有权归属于杭州海康威视数字技术股份有限公司,未经授权,禁止进行任何形式的复制、翻译或修改。同时,手册也声明了产品仅适用于中国大陆地区,并且在法律允许的范围内,产品按照现有状态提供,不提供任何形式的保证,对于因使用产品或手册所导致的损失,公司不承担任何赔偿责任。 手册还特别警示用户,将产品接入互联网可能面临风险,如网络攻击、黑客入侵或病毒感染,用户需自行承担这些风险。同时,用户必须遵守适用的法律法规,不得将产品用于侵犯第三方权利或不当用途,否则公司将不承担任何责任。 在操作前,手册提供了符号约定,包括说明、注意和危险等级的标识,帮助用户理解文档中关键信息的重要性。例如,“注意”用于提醒用户重要操作或...
源码下载地址: https://pan.quark.cn/s/a4b39357ea24 gddrxy综合性实验——某系统的设计与实现---互联网应用开发(JSP)4 1. 在MySQL数据库中构建用于实验的数据表,要求包含至少三个字段,并在其中至少加入一条数据记录 2. 设计一个数据录入界面,将用户提交的信息发送至Servlet以执行合法性验证,若验证通过则调用DAO组件向数据表中追加一条新记录 实验报告 实验名称:综合性实验——某系统的设计与实现(互联网应用开发——JSP) 一、实验目的与要求 本次实验旨在使学生深入掌握并熟练运用JavaServer Pages (JSP) 技术开展互联网应用开发工作,特别是在数据库交互方面的实践。通过本次实践操作,期望达成以下学习目标: 1. 精通JSP在数据库层面的增删改查(Create, Read, Update, Delete)操作,包括建立数据库连接、执行SQL指令以及管理结果集等环节。 2. 掌握Servlet的生命周期机制,理解其在Web系统中的功能定位与工作流程。 3. 学会构建动态网页,实现用户输入信息的采集,并在服务器端完成数据校验与处理流程。 二、实验原理与内容 1. JSP进行数据库操作的典型流程涵盖数据库连接建立、SQL指令执行、结果集处理以及连接关闭等多个关键步骤。 2. Servlet作为Java Web应用程序的核心构成部分之一,具有初始化、服务、销毁这三个生命周期阶段。在本次实验中,Servlet将负责接收并处理来自JSP页面的请求,完成数据合法性校验工作。 三、实验步骤与结果 1. 数据库准备: - 采用MySQL数据库创建一个实验用的数据表,例如命名"Student",表中包含"ID"(作...
内容概要:本文详细介绍了基于风光储能和需求响应的微电网日前经济调度模型的Python代码实现,重点探讨了在风能、光伏等可再生能源出力具有不确定性的背景下,如何结合储能系统的运行特性与用户侧的需求响应机制,实现微电网系统的日前优化调度。该模型通过构建精确的数学模型并结合高效的优化算法,对分布式电源、储能设备及可控负荷进行协调优化,旨在最小化系统运行成本、提升可再生能源的消纳水平,并确保供电的安全性与稳定性。文中提供的完整Python代码实现了从数据输入、模型构建到求解分析的全流程,便于读者复现、验证与二次开发。; 适合人群:具备一定电力系统基础知识和Python编程能力,从事新能源、微电网、智能电网等相关领域研究的研究生、科研人员及工程技术人员。; 使用场景及目标:①用于高校或科研机构开展微电网优化调度相关课题的教学与科研工作;②为实际微电网项目的日前调度策略设计提供技术支撑与仿真验证工具;③帮助研究人员深入掌握基于Python平台的能源系统建模与优化求解方法。; 阅读建议:建议读者结合文档中的理论推导与代码实现同步学习,重点关注目标函数设计、约束条件建模及优化求解器调用等关键环节,并尝试调整参数设置或拓展模型结构以适配不同应用场景。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

inscode_052

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值